Mining Incidents
Fatality · MSHA Record #219841840017

Motorman

May 31, 1984 at 8:01 PM
Ore Haulage Plant · Facility · Metal/Non-Metal
Salt Lake County, UT
Classification SLIP OR FALL OF PERSON
Type Fall to lower level, (Not Elsewhere Classified)
Investigator narrative
HE FELL INTO "GLORY HOLE" WAS FROUND IN "27" BUILDING ON ORE BELT. "GLORY HOLE" IS THE ORE CAR DUMP.
